Description
ST515N is a high-performance, multi-purpose 5.8GHz wireless bridge product with Qualcomm core solution. High TX power, high-quality hardware and a built-in 15dBi directional antenna make it an ideal choice for medium and short-range transmissions. It is recommended to be used in the last 3 kilometers , and the longest transmission distance can reach 5 kilometers. It is suitable for various video surveillance scenarios such as agriculture, forestry, industry, commerce, transportation and docks. The iPoll 3 intelligent dynamic polling protocol based on TDMA technology is well-known in the wireless industry for its excellent anti-interference ability. Even in high-density and severe interference scenarios, iPoll 3 can still ensure stable transmission and higher throughput. iPoll 3 supports wireless traffic optimization, the QoS priority supports DSCP mode under 802.1p, 4 priority queues is supported and the most complete support for multiple services has been provided. The product design meets the IP-66 waterproof level, and relevant indicators such as temperature and humidity are in line with industrial standards, along with the 2kv surge resistance design to protect the device in complex electrical environments, the product has high reliability.
